It has flattened sides that can attach magnetically to, and be wirelessly charged by, recent iPad models with flat sides ( 3rd generation iPad Pro, 4th generation iPad Air, or later) The second Apple Pencil was announced at an Apple special event on Octoand released on the following November 7th. Apple Pencil (1st generation) You can use Apple Pencil (1st generation) with these iPad models: iPad mini (5th generation) iPad (6th generation and later) iPad Air (3rd generation) iPad Pro 12.9-inch (1st and 2nd generation) iPad Pro 10.5-inch. It is charged through the Lightning connector, which can be exposed by pulling the cap off the opposite end from the tip. It has a round cross section with a smooth finish. The first Apple Pencil was announced along with the 1st generation iPad Pro at an Apple special event on Septemand released on the following November 11th.
